Key concepts and overview

At their core, crash games are based on a simple premise: players place bets on a multiplier that increases over time until it "crashes." The objective is to cash out before the multiplier crashes, allowing players to maximize their winnings. This straightforward concept is what makes crash games accessible to a wide audience, yet it also requires a level of strategic thinking and risk management that appeals to experienced gamblers. The thrill of watching the multiplier rise, combined with the tension of deciding when to cash out, creates an engaging gaming experience that keeps players coming back for more.

Main features and details

Crash games typically feature a user-friendly interface that displays the current multiplier and a countdown timer. Players can place their bets at any time during the game, and the multiplier continues to rise until it crashes, which can happen at any moment. This unpredictability is a key element of the game's appeal. Additionally, many crash games offer various betting options, allowing players to choose their stake and adjust their risk level accordingly. Some platforms even provide features such as auto-cashout, where players can set a predetermined multiplier to cash out automatically, adding another layer of strategy to the game.

Advantages and disadvantages

Like any gambling format, crash games come with their own set of advantages and disadvantages. One of the primary advantages is the potential for high returns in a short amount of time, which can be particularly appealing for players looking for quick thrills. The simplicity of the game also makes it easy to understand and play, attracting a broad audience. However, the inherent volatility of crash games can lead to significant losses if players are not careful. The pressure to make quick decisions can also be overwhelming, especially for those who may not have a solid strategy in place. Thus, while crash games can be exciting and profitable, they also require a careful approach to mitigate risks.
